I think your definition of "Exotic" is more leaning towards just a rare car. In my opinion, a '67 Shelby GT500KR is a muscle car, an extremely rare and beautiful one at that. A smart car.. is well.. different, but I wouldn't call it an exotic.

An exotic to me is a rare car, but also has unique/aggressive style, a solid engine, and usually (but not always) a crazy price tag to match. So I'd say a Lotus Elise, a Ford GT, a Lamborghini Murcielago, a Corvette ZR1, a Ferrari F430 etc.. you get the picture.. are all exotics.
